A Return to Seller Financing in 2009?
Posted on 02 February 2009 by Jamie Beck
Due to the tightening credit market, many experts believe that seller financing will make a major comeback this year.
Akron Ohio News reports:
“Creative financing’ is one of the items that is ‘in’ for 2009, according to an annual survey conducted by Mark Nash, a Coldwell Banker broker and real estate author who uses a network of 839 Realtors® in all 50 states and eight Canadian provinces to acquire consumer responses to a variety of housing questions.
Nash…believes that seller financing, or “carrying the paper” will return to popularity this year along with the lease-option.”
Not everyone is in a position to offer seller financing. But, for those who can, it’s often a smart way to attract buyers in a down market.
